Hi all, With Debian 7.7 AMIs distributed a week ago (https://lists.debian.org/debian-cloud/2014/10/msg00009.html) and now also included in Frankfurt (https://lists.debian.org/debian-cloud/2014/10/msg00029.html), I'm going sun-set the 7.6.aws.2 AMIs for around 4 weeks away, Friday 21st November 2014.
Wheezy 7.7 AMIs have just been passed to the AWS Marketplace team today for distribution there as well. Any CloudFormation templates and/or AutoScale groups that reference these deprecated AMIs should be updated to use newer AMIs. If you wish to preserve these images yourself, you may launch an instance from these AMIs, then create a new AMI of the running instance saved in your account to keep it. Note that you will start paying for the storage of the snapshot (for EBS backed AMIs) or S3 storage (for S3 backed AMIs) corresponding to the instance at the time you create your own image. A short time after public access for these outdated AMIs has been removed, I will then dispose of these old images unless someone needs them re-enabled and extended for a period.
